Intake for National Rural Youth Service Corps in Free State

The Department of Rural Development and Land Reform in conjunction with the Department of Public Works and Land Reform in the Free State invites members of the media to the official welcoming of young people to the National Rural Youth Service Corps (NARYSEC) in Free State. The event will be held at the Thabu-Nchu College on Tuesday 01 February 2011.

Premier of the Free State Mr Ace Magashule will deliver the keynote address. Other dignitaries expected to attend the event are the MEC for Public Works and Land Reform and the Executive Mayor of Mangaung Local Municipality Mr Playfair Morule.

NARYSEC is a two-year programme that targets youth from 18 to 35 from rural areas and in possession of Grade 10 report. The programme is aimed at empowering the youth with various skills and is expected to create about 10 000 job opportunities for at least four youths from the 3000 rural wards in the country.
